Transaction 7a60db190e7f1d41b9a93d5a9ba00e32f47108b4a39284f7d5696dd97d683328

3 Input
2 Outputs
  • 7a60db190e7f1d41b9a93d5a9ba00e32f47108b4a39284f7d5696dd97d683328:0
  • value  2752587
    address  12dYKZHv9TKCBRtvTVvjV6QWU5ApUXLuTR
  • 7a60db190e7f1d41b9a93d5a9ba00e32f47108b4a39284f7d5696dd97d683328:1
  • value  8918900
    address  36vg7JiP13z537x7jBWXvfrShi4cVdRhwt